Sažetak
Ultrasound-assisted extraction (UAE) of oleuropein (OLE), verbascoside (VER) and luteolin-4'-O-glucoside (L4OG), as the major phenolics from olive leaves, was optimized using response surface methodology (RSM). A Box-Behnken design (BBD) was used to monitor the effect of different modes of ultrasound operation (pulsed and continuous), liquid-solid (L-S) ratio and sonication time on each phenolic yield. The yield of UAE and conventional solid extraction (CSE) was determined after performing UHPLC-DAD analysis on the extracts. The results suggested that under optimal conditions, the concentrations of OLE, VER, and L4OG were 13.386, 0.363 and 0.527 mg/g dry powdered olive leaves (DPOL), respectively. Verification of experiments was carried out under the modified optimal conditions and the relative errors between the predicted and experimental values were dependent on the examined phenolic compound (OLE 8.63%, VER 11.3% and L4OG 22.48%). In comparison with CSE, UAE improved the yield of OLE, VER and L4OG (32.6%, 41.8%, and 47.5%, respectively after 1 min) at a temperature of 60 oC, an L-S ratio of 15 (v/w), and in the continuous mode of UAE. We demonstrated that the UAE technique is an efficient method for enhancing yields of OLE, VER, and L4OG in olive leaves extracts, while the chosen model was adequate to optimize extraction of major phenolic compounds from olive leaves.
